We’ve been tracking the instability issues with our cameras and one of the issues we found is the following:
#include <chrono>
#include <iostream>
#include <iterator>
#include <mutex>
#include <ranges>
#include <syncstream>
#include <vector>
#include <thread>
#include <utility>
#include <sl/CameraOne.hpp>
int main(int argc, char* argv[]) {
// std::mutex mutex { };
auto func = [&](auto stopToken, auto& device) {
sl::InitParametersOne initParams { };
initParams.camera_resolution = sl::RESOLUTION::HD1080;
initParams.camera_fps = 15;
initParams.sdk_verbose = 1;
initParams.input.setFromSerialNumber(device.serial_number);
sl::CameraOne camera { };
{
// std::lock_guard lock { mutex };
if (auto err = camera.open(initParams); err != sl::ERROR_CODE::SUCCESS) {
std::cout << "open failed: " << sl::toString(err) << std::endl;
return;
}
}
std::size_t counter { 0 };
while (!stopToken.stop_requested()) {
auto t1 = std::chrono::steady_clock::now();
if (auto err = camera.grab(); err != sl::ERROR_CODE::SUCCESS) {
std::osyncstream(std::cout) << counter << " " << std::chrono::steady_clock::now() - t1 << " error" << std::endl;
} else {
std::osyncstream(std::cout) << counter << " " << std::chrono::steady_clock::now() - t1 << " ok" << std::endl;
}
++counter;
std::this_thread::sleep_for(std::chrono::milliseconds { 10 });
}
std::osyncstream(std::cout) << "thread closing" << std::endl;
camera.close();
std::osyncstream(std::cout) << "thread done" << std::endl;
};
std::vector<std::jthread> threads { };
std::ranges::copy(
sl::CameraOne::getDeviceList() |
std::ranges::views::filter([](auto&& d) {
return d.camera_model == sl::MODEL::ZED_XONE_GS ||
d.camera_model == sl::MODEL::ZED_XONE_UHD ||
d.camera_model == sl::MODEL::ZED_XONE_HDR;
}) |
std::ranges::views::take(3) |
std::ranges::views::transform([&](auto&& d) {
return std::jthread { [d, &func](auto stopToken) {
return func(stopToken, d);
} };
}),
std::back_inserter(threads)
);
std::osyncstream(std::cout) << "sleeping for 15s" << std::endl;
std::this_thread::sleep_for(std::chrono::seconds { 15 });
std::ranges::for_each(
threads,
[](auto&& t) {
t.request_stop();
t.join();
}
);
std::cout << "done" << std::endl;
return 0;
}

Three Zed X One cameras, Zed Link Capture Card Duo, ZedSDK 5.4.1, CUDA version: V13.2.86, on Jetson Orin NX with Jetpack 7.2.1, the program is compiled with gcc 13.3.0 with thread sanitizer enabled. ZED_Diagnostics is green. The program above gives the first report on `open` and the second one on `grab`:

Fwiw, while undesirable synchronising around `open` eliminates the first report. Doing the same for `grab` isn’t really possible.
